Gym sessions

The Gym sessions page is the coach's read-out of strength work actually done — every session athletes have logged, whether from a plan you assigned or logged off-plan on their phone.

Who can use it: admins and coaches can review. Athletes do the logging, in the player app.

Gym is a per-org feature — if it's switched off in Settings, the whole Gym section disappears.

What you see

A list of executions from the last 90 days. Each row shows the athlete, the session or template name, when it started, and:

  • Statuscompleted (finished as planned), in progress (started, not yet finished), or abandoned (started over a day ago and never completed).
  • Tonnage — total weight moved across the session (sets × reps × load summed).
  • Session RPE — the athlete's perceived exertion (0–10), an estimate of how hard the session felt internally.

Click a session to see the set-by-set detail: every exercise, the load, and the reps completed against what was prescribed.

How to use it

Skim for abandoned or in-progress sessions, watch session RPE for efforts that felt much harder or easier than intended, and use tonnage trends to see whether an athlete's strength volume is climbing. For per-athlete adherence over time, the squad engagement heatmap is the better view.
